Australian hip-hop star Iggy Azalea is hitting it big in the States, but that has just made the target on her bank account as big as it full. Specifically, her ex-boyfriend — or current husband, depending on who you believe — who's looking to divorce the "Booty" emcee for a piece of her booty.
There might be one problem with his plan, however: she says they've never been married. Texan Hefe Wine (aka Maurice Williams) is saying in court documents that he and Azalea have been common-law married since 2008. In most of the country, that means he's entitled to half of her current booming business.
In Texas, a couple who live together for any amount of time are considered legally married if they agree to be wed and hold themselves out to others as a married couple. Azalea's reps say she never agreed to either of those conditions. Not according to him, however, who said the couple "agreed to be married, holding themselves out as man and wife and began residing together in the state of Texas on or about September 2008."
Wine is asking a court to bar Azalea from selling various assets accumulated during their union. They have previously been at odds over the rights to music she penned while they were together. If a judge recognizes the validity of the marriage then the "Fancy" rapper's music becomes community property and could be split 50/50.
But Azalea isn't having any of it. She says that the move is just a cash grab, and their relationship, romantic or otherwise, only lasted six months. It will be interesting to see how this one turns out.
